The Surprising Benefits of Pork Bones (When Prepared Properly)

When processed correctly, pork bones can be a valuable source of nutrients. However, these benefits are derived almost exclusively from simmering the bones for an extended period to create a broth, which extracts the beneficial compounds into the liquid, rather than by consuming the solid bone itself.

A Powerhouse of Collagen and Gelatin

One of the most notable advantages of pork bones is their high concentration of collagen, a protein that is vital for skin health, joint function, and connective tissues. During the slow simmering process, this collagen breaks down into gelatin, which gives the broth its rich, viscous texture. Gelatin is then converted into amino acids in the body, such as glycine and proline, which are essential for overall health. Research suggests that increased dietary intake of collagen can lead to improved skin elasticity and hydration.

A Source of Amino Acids for Gut Health

Beyond external benefits, the amino acids from bone broth, particularly gelatin, are thought to support a healthy digestive system. Some studies suggest that gelatin may help protect and heal the mucosal lining of the digestive tract, a benefit for those with gastrointestinal issues like leaky gut. Glycine has also been shown to possess anti-inflammatory properties that may help reduce gut-related inflammation.

Nutrient-Dense Bone Marrow

Inside the bones is marrow, a fatty, nutrient-rich substance that dissolves into the broth during cooking. Bone marrow is considered a “superfood” and provides valuable vitamins and minerals, including some B vitamins, iron, and healthy fats. In traditional cultures, bone marrow has been prized for its nourishing properties and rich flavor.

The Extreme Dangers of Eating Solid Cooked Pork Bones

While the broth offers benefits, attempting to eat solid pork bones is extremely dangerous and can have severe, even life-threatening, consequences. Cooked bones, especially, become brittle and prone to splintering, creating sharp, jagged fragments.

The Risk of Choking and Internal Perforation

Swallowing sharp bone fragments can lead to a host of medical emergencies. Fragments can get lodged in the throat, causing choking, or can damage the esophagus. The sharp pieces can travel further into the digestive tract, where they can cause intestinal obstruction, perforation, or internal bleeding. Elderly individuals, young children, or those with dental issues are particularly susceptible.

The Threat of Parasitic Contamination

All pork must be cooked thoroughly to eliminate the risk of parasitic infections. Raw or undercooked pork can harbor parasites such as Trichinella roundworms and tapeworms like Taenia solium. Symptoms can range from mild gastrointestinal upset to severe, sometimes fatal, complications involving the heart or brain. This is why raw bones, or any undercooked pork, are a hazard, even for broth-making, and why proper sanitation is paramount.

Comparison: Solid Pork Bones vs. Nutrient-Rich Broth

To clarify the difference, here is a comparison between consuming solid pork bones directly and consuming a broth made from them:

Feature Solid Pork Bones Pork Bone Broth
Safety Profile Extremely Dangerous. High risk of splintering, choking, and internal injury. Very Safe. Nutrients are extracted into liquid; solid bone is strained out.
Nutrient Delivery Nutrients are locked within the indigestible bone structure. Nutrients like collagen, gelatin, and minerals are bioavailable in the liquid.
Preparation No safe preparation method for human consumption. Slow-simmered for 12-24 hours with water and acid (like vinegar).
Digestibility Indigestible, can cause blockages. Liquid is easily digestible and soothing for the gut lining.

Addressing Heavy Metal Concerns

There have been public concerns regarding the potential for heavy metals, such as lead, to leach from bones into broths. While animal bones can contain trace amounts of heavy metals, studies indicate that the levels extracted into broth are minimal and generally not considered a health risk when consumed in moderation. A 2017 study concluded that lead levels in broths are in the microgram range per serving, posing a minimal risk. For best results, use bones from reputable sources, preferably organically raised, to minimize exposure to contaminants.

Safe Methods for Nutrient Extraction

  • Long-simmered broth: Cover bones with water, add a splash of apple cider vinegar, and simmer for 12-24 hours to draw out nutrients.
  • Straining is essential: Always strain the broth through a fine-mesh sieve to remove all solid particles, bone fragments, and spices before consuming.
  • Tender meat on the bone: While avoiding the bone itself, the connective tissues and meat surrounding the bones on cuts like trotters or neck bones can be slow-cooked until very tender and safely consumed.
  • Proper food handling: Always follow strict food safety guidelines, such as cooking pork to a safe internal temperature, to avoid contamination.

What to Avoid

  • Chewing or swallowing cooked bones: Never chew on or swallow cooked pork bones, as they are brittle and can cause significant harm.
  • Feeding cooked bones to pets: Cooked bones are dangerous for dogs and other pets for the same reason they are dangerous for humans.
  • Undercooked pork: Consuming raw or undercooked pork of any kind, including bones, risks parasitic infection.
